+config BR2_PACKAGE_IPERF3
+       bool "iperf3"
+       depends on B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HAS_THREADS
+       help
+         iperf is a tool for active measurements of the maximum
+         achievable bandwidth on IP networks.
+         It supports tuning of various parameters related to timing,
+         protocols, and buffers. For each test it reports the bandwidth,
+         loss, and other parameters.
+         It's a redesign of the NLANR/DAST iperf(2) and is not
+         backward compatible.
+
+         https://github.com/esnet/iperf
+
+comment "iperf3 needs a toolchain w/ threads"
+       depends on !B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HAS_THREADS
